Factors to Consider When Choosing Powered Speakers for Turntable

When you’re picking powered speakers for your turntable, consider a few key factors. First, think about the audio quality; clear sound can make a big difference. You’ll also want to check connectivity options, power output, design, and your budget to find the perfect match.
Audio Quality Importance
Choosing powered speakers for your turntable isn’t just about picking something that looks nice. Audio quality is key. You want speakers with dynamic drivers and a high signal-to-noise ratio—aim for 70 dB or higher. This helps reduce distortion, ensuring every note shines through. Don’t forget the wattage; look for at least 30W for fuller sound and clarity at higher volumes. Consider speaker enclosures, too; wooden cabinets offer better resonance control, improving overall sound. It’s also great to have EQ controls for adjusting bass and treble. This lets you fine-tune the sound to match your taste and room acoustics. With these factors in mind, you’ll enjoy a richer vinyl listening experience.
Connectivity Options Available
Getting the right connectivity options is essential for enjoying your vinyl collection. Look for powered speakers that offer multiple input options, like RCA and AUX. These allow you to connect directly from your turntable without extra gadgets. Bluetooth functionality is also a plus, enabling you to stream music wirelessly from your smartphone or tablet.
Don’t forget about optical and coaxial inputs. These provide a lossless connection to modern devices, like TVs or computers. If you love deep bass, consider speakers with a subwoofer output to link an external subwoofer. Finally, make sure the speakers match your turntable’s output. Power Output Considerations
After confirming your powered speakers have the right connectivity options, it’s important to focus on power output. You’ll want speakers rated between 30W and 42W RMS for solid sound quality without distortion at moderate volumes. Since turntables often output lower signals, pick powered speakers with built-in amplifiers. This way, they’ll amplify the audio signal effectively. Also, consider the impedance rating of the speakers. Matching the impedance to your turntable helps prevent potential damage from mismatched power outputs. If you’re in a smaller room, lower wattage speakers might work fine. However, for larger spaces, aim for speakers with around 40W or more to guarantee the best sound coverage. Frequently Asked Questions
Can Powered Speakers Connect Directly to Any Turntable Model?
Yes, powered speakers can connect directly to many turntable models, but it depends on the turntable’s output. Most modern turntables have a built-in phono preamp, allowing you to plug them straight into the speakers. If your turntable doesn’t have this feature, you’ll need an external phono preamp between them. Always check your speakers for compatibility, and use RCA cables for the connection. It’s that simple! Do I Need an Amplifier for Powered Speakers?
No, you don’t need an amplifier for powered speakers. They come with built-in amps, so they’re ready to rock right out of the box. Just plug them into your turntable and enjoy. If your turntable has a built-in preamp, you’re all set. If not, you might need a standalone preamp to boost the signal. Always check your speaker specs to guarantee a smooth, hassle-free connection. How Do I Position Powered Speakers for Optimal Sound?
To position powered speakers for ideal sound, start by placing them at ear level when you’re seated. Keep a distance of at least 1-2 feet from walls to avoid unwanted reflections. You should angle them slightly towards your listening area for better sound clarity. Avoid corners, as this can cause muddiness. Are There Specific Cables Required for Connecting Turntables to Powered Speakers?
Yes, you need specific cables. Generally, a pair of RCA cables does the trick. These cables usually have red and white connectors. If your turntable has a built-in preamp, just plug the RCA cables from the turntable directly into the powered speakers. If not, you’ll need to add a preamp in between. What Is the Difference Between Passive and Powered Speakers for Turntables?
The main difference between passive and powered speakers lies in their built-in amplification. Powered speakers have amplifiers inside, so you simply connect them to your turntable. Passive speakers, on the other hand, need an external amplifier to work. This means you’ll need extra equipment for passive speakers. If you’re just starting, powered speakers are often easier to set up, while passive speakers allow for more customization in your audio system.
